Concert Raises Funds For DSS Breakfast Program

By: Ben 
            The cafeteria at Dunnville Secondary School (DSS) was alive with local musicians on Thursday, October 6 in support of the school's breakfast program.  Local artists included In the Shadows, a band consisting of Rikki Lynn Hoffman-Stinson, EJ Hoffman-Stinson, and Caleb Smith, all students of DSS.  The night featured piano virtuoso, Connor Dockrill, a graduate of DSS.  Dockrill was accompanied by his sister, Laura Dockrill; father, Kevin Dockrill; and Carl Slick.
            The concert was a fundraiser for the breakfast program that takes place at DSS.  Every morning, a variety of healthy breakfast foods are supplied by the school for all students to take at no cost to them.  Funding is needed to allow the program to maintain its variety and high standard. 
            This concert was the first of a monthly coffee house that will continue to take place throughout the year.  Aside from raising funds for the breakfast program, this allows students and local artists to have a place to showcase their talents.  "I always enjoy coming back to play at the school," said Dockrill.  Rikki Lynn Hoffman-Stinson, bassist and singer of In the Shadows, also helped to set up the night.  She thanks all of the musicians for their support and making the night such a great success.
